All’s Not Calm (Revelation 12:13–17)

We have considered the opening two visions of Revelation 12 under the broad theme of “A Cosmic Christmas.” In vv. 1–6, we considered the violent night in which the dragon tried to end the promise of Messiah’s birth. In vv. 7–12, we saw the holy war in which Michael and his angels fought against the dragon and his angels. In the third vision (vv. 13–17), we see that all’s not calm as the dragon, having failed to defeat Messiah, turns his fury against Messiah’s people.

Scripture References: Revelation 12:13-17
